Hardcover. John Muir Climbs a Tree and Other Tree Tales is a collection of stories that explores humanity's deep and universal connection to trees. From climbing branches as children to finding quiet moments beneath their shade, these experiences feel both personal and shared. W. Jim Cortese brings together a rich mix of history, folklore, and personal reflection, inviting readers into a world where trees are more than part of the landscape. They are places of memory, wonder, and meaning. Inspired by voices like John Muir, the anthology highlights themes of exploration, resilience, and the quiet wisdom found in nature. This book is for anyone who has ever climbed a tree, walked through the woods, or paused to appreciate the natural world. It is a reminder that even the simplest moments outdoors can leave a lasting impression. This item is printed on demand.
